1. 目的
在操作Linux时,经常缺少软件或者依赖,服务器可能处于离线状态,无法连接上网上的yum源,安装软件和以来很头疼。
但其实操作系统的iso中一般就自带有yum安装包源,可以进行配置。
当然,推荐这个iso和操作系统安装时候使用的iso是同一个,确保版本一致。
2. 配置
先挂载iso到某一个目录下,如/media
mount xxx.iso /media
把/etc/yum.repo.d/目录下所有的.repo文件备份。如进行以下操作(mv命令执行过程的报错可以忽略):
mkdir /etc/yum.repos.d/old
mv /etc/yum.repos.d/* /etc/yum.repos.d/old
然后新建文件,写入以下内容
# vi /etc/yum.repos.d/local.repo
[local]
name=local
baseurl=file:///media # 注意这里有三条斜杠/
enabled=1
gpgcheck=0
3. 验证是否生效
在命令行执行以下内容
yum clean all
yum makecache fast